Free Floyd--Tour Cheat or Champion?
Floyd Landis gives compelling arguments for his defense in reclaiming his yellow jersey champion title to the 2006 Tour de France. In a very readable and engaging narrative, Floyd & his co-author lay out his story in the pro peloton. From his humble Mennonite beginnings to his fast track as super domestique to Lance Armstrong, Floyd's story is an interesting read for cycling fans or anyone who is interested in the complexities of drug testing in sport. A great insiders look at the politics and mechanisms of pro cycling. Is it true? Who knows, but he sure examines many of the problems in the system of the World Anti-Doping effort in sports while telling his fascinating story. Only time, the World Anti-Doping Agency, and the UCI will secure Floyd's place in cycling history as either cheat & liar extraordinaire or the greatest injustice to a true champion. Nonetheless, his memoir of the whole affair should stand up to time in either case as a colossal denial or a heartfelt self-defense of the truth.
